C4F6, or hexafluorobutadiene, is a colorless gas with a faint sweet odor. It is a highly reactive element and reacts with most substances and its compounds are used in a wide variety of chemical reactions. Composed of carbon and fluorine atoms, this gas is what makes it so special.
